Tough Cookies is a comedy television series that aired on CBS in 1986; six episodes were broadcast.[ citation needed]
Chicago police detective Cliff Brady ( Robby Benson) is dating an older woman named Rita ( Lainie Kazan), who is not sure she can handle their relationship.[ citation needed]
